  1. L’ Université populaire européenne (UPE) est une des deux principales associations d’éducation populaire d’Alsace. Son siège est à Strasbourg mais elle est également implantée dans le Nord de l'Alsace avec l'Upe Nord Alsace, dont le siège est à Haguenau. Prés de 10 000 personnes la fréquentent.

The ROTTnROCK project by Michael Heap, teacher-researcher at the Institut Terre et Environnement de Strasbourg (University of Strasbourg/CNRS /Engees) is the winner of an ERC Synergy grants 2023. The aim of the project is to understand the phenomena inside active volcanoes in order to anticipate risks.

  4. La Universidad de Estrasburgo (université de Strasbourg en francés) es una universidad pública francesa con sede en la ciudad de Estrasburgo, Alsacia. Es una universidad multidisciplinaria con más de 50.000 estudiantes (20% de estudiantes extranjeros) y 2.755 profesores e investigadores. [1]

The University of Strasbourg dates back to the 16th century, but the institution in its current form was founded in 2009, following the merger of Louis Pasteur, Marc Bloch and Robert Schuman universities. The university was divided into these three institutions in 1971. The university offers a range of degrees including diplomas, bachelor’s, masters’s, and doctoral courses. The largest ...
